Riba-roja de Turia

Riba-roja de Túria is considered one of the most important archaeological sites of the Visigothic period. The Plà de Nadal, with its residential complex belonging to a Visigothic Dux from the 8th century, attests to this historical significance

The town aims to share this experience with its visitors and organizes the Dux Festival every year, a historical reenactment of the era that includes guided tours, performances, music, a craft market, and gastronomy.

In addition to its history, in the present day, Riba-roja de Túria boasts a industrious population and an attractive natural environment dominated by the final stretch of the Turia River. It is an ideal setting for recreational and sports activities.
